Who funds Way to Grow?

Way to Grow is funded by 67 grantmakers, led by Wem Foundation ($10.4M), The Constellation Fund ($1.2M), Lre Foundation ($900K). In total, IRS Form 990 filings record $20.5M in grants to Way to Grow between 2020–2025.
